4-Acetoxycinnamyl alcohol

Details

Top
Internal ID 9e596768-42c1-42a5-8b6d-73704c7ea02b
Taxonomy Benzenoids > Phenol esters
IUPAC Name [4-(3-hydroxyprop-1-enyl)phenyl] acetate
SMILES (Canonical) CC(=O)OC1=CC=C(C=C1)C=CCO
SMILES (Isomeric) CC(=O)OC1=CC=C(C=C1)C=CCO
InChI InChI=1S/C11H12O3/c1-9(13)14-11-6-4-10(5-7-11)3-2-8-12/h2-7,12H,8H2,1H3
InChI Key MUHNYWKQFOFBRC-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Popularity 5 references in papers

Physical and Chemical Properties

Top
Molecular Formula C11H12O3
Molecular Weight 192.21 g/mol
Exact Mass 192.078644241 g/mol
Topological Polar Surface Area (TPSA) 46.50 Ų
XlogP 1.50
Atomic LogP (AlogP) 1.62
H-Bond Acceptor 3
H-Bond Donor 1
Rotatable Bonds 3
